Unconfirmed details should not be presented as part of the verified aspect of the incident.\u003C\u002Fp> \u003Ch2>Leaked Data Types and Risks\u003C\u002Fh2> \u003Cp>Among the most critical information leaked in the Reincubate \u003Cstrong>data breach\u003C\u002Fstrong> are users' email addresses and passwords. Email addresses serve as the first point of contact for attackers. These addresses can be used in targeted phishing campaigns or spam messages. The inclusion of users' names in the list also allows these attacks to become more personal and convincing. For example, attackers may try to obtain sensitive information with fake emails starting with \"Dear [User's Name]\" that appear to come from a trusted source.\u003C\u002Fp> \u003Cp>However, the greatest risk is the leakage of passwords. If users use the same password on the Reincubate platform and other online services, this poses a significant threat to all their accounts. Attackers can gain unauthorized access to accounts by trying the username-password combinations they have obtained on other platforms. This method is called 'credential stuffing' and is commonly used to take over a large number of accounts. As a result, users may suffer financial losses or damage to their reputation.\u003C\u002Fp> \u003Cul> \u003Cli>\u003Cstrong>Email Addresses:\u003C\u002Fstrong> They can be used for phishing attacks, sending spam, and targeted advertising.\u003C\u002Fli> \u003Cli>\u003Cstrong>Names:\u003C\u002Fstrong> Used in attack scenarios that make personal information more convincing.\u003C\u002Fli> \u003Cli>\u003Cstrong>Passwords:\u003C\u002Fstrong> It is the most dangerous type of data. It is used to gain unauthorized access to users' other accounts.\u003C\u002Fli> \u003C\u002Ful> \u003Ch2>Verified Scope and User Impact\u003C\u002Fh2> \u003Cp>Evaluation for Reincubate registration should be carried out based on recorded data classes rather than unverified attack method predictions. Unconfirmed details should not be presented as part of the verified aspect of the incident.\u003C\u002Fp> \u003Ch2>User Groups at Risk\u003C\u002Fh2> \u003Cp>The user groups most affected by the Reincubate \u003Cstrong>data leak\u003C\u002Fstrong> are undoubtedly individuals who use the same passwords on multiple platforms. These users are at serious risk not only for their Reincubate accounts but also for all other online services (email, banking, social media, etc.) where they use the same password. Attackers can try the credentials they have obtained on thousands of different sites using automated tools.\u003C\u002Fp> \u003Cp>Using the same password on platforms that particularly contain sensitive information or where financial transactions are conducted can lead to identity theft and direct financial losses. For example, if a user's email address and password are leaked, attackers can access this email account and reset the passwords of other accounts, thereby gaining control over the entire digital life space. This situation can affect not only individual users but also the businesses or organizations to which these users are connected, indirectly.\u003C\u002Fp> \u003Cp>Secondary threats should not be ignored either. Leaked email addresses and names can be used for more sophisticated social engineering attacks. Attackers may try to gain users' trust by using their personal information and direct them to fake websites or get them to download malicious software. Therefore, the consequences of such data breaches are not limited to the direct use of the leaked data; they can open the door to broader and more complex cybercrime activities.\u003C\u002Fp> \u003Ch2>Urgent Measures to Be Taken\u003C\u002Fh2> \u003Col> \u003Cli>\u003Cstrong>Password Change:\u003C\u002Fstrong> Immediately change the password for your Reincubate account.
